Akeneo and Contentstack complement each other well in enterprise content operations. Akeneo serves as the system of record for product information, assets, and localization workflows, while Contentstack delivers modular, API-driven digital experiences across websites, apps, and other customer touchpoints. Integrating the two platforms helps teams keep product content consistent, reduce manual rework, and accelerate omnichannel publishing.
Data flow: Akeneo to Contentstack
Use Akeneo as the source of truth for product attributes, descriptions, technical specifications, and localized content, then push approved product data into Contentstack to build product detail pages, landing pages, and campaign experiences.
Data flow: Bi-directional, with Akeneo as the product hub and Contentstack as the experience layer
Akeneo already manages product-linked assets such as brochures, spec sheets, and installation guides. These assets can be surfaced in Contentstack to enrich product pages, support content hubs, and service documentation areas.
Data flow: Akeneo to Contentstack
Akeneo can provide translated product titles, descriptions, and attributes to Contentstack for use in regional websites, microsites, and country-specific campaign pages. This is especially valuable when product content is translated through external translation management systems and then returned to Akeneo.
Data flow: Akeneo to Contentstack
Akeneo can feed structured product attributes into Contentstack to power comparison tables, feature highlights, compatibility charts, and technical specification modules on digital experiences.
Data flow: Akeneo to Contentstack
When product status, pricing-related attributes, availability flags, or key descriptions change in Akeneo, those updates can trigger content refreshes in Contentstack. This is useful for product launches, seasonal campaigns, and regulated product updates.
Data flow: Contentstack to Akeneo
Campaign copy, editorial messaging, and brand-approved content created in Contentstack can be referenced by Akeneo-based product teams when preparing product descriptions, launch materials, or channel-specific content packages.
Data flow: Bi-directional
Akeneo can provide product facts and assets while Contentstack contributes editorial content, banners, buying guides, and campaign modules. Together, they can support omnichannel delivery to websites, mobile apps, digital catalogs, and retailer-facing experiences.
Data flow: Contentstack to Akeneo
Contentstack analytics can reveal which product pages, content modules, or calls to action perform best. Those insights can be used by product and content teams to refine product descriptions, attribute emphasis, and asset selection in Akeneo.
